wintechgroup

epices-millesaveurs

lequipe228

padfa

osworldcompany

aspamnews

wintechgroup

epices-millesaveurs

lequipe228

padfa

osworldcompany

aspamnews

amenagerie

cfdtdivia

clicinformatique62

studios

tendeserra

levelvett

agencetil

moncreditinfo

bubenhomes

Whoa!

I dove into DeFi last fall and things changed quickly. At first it felt like the wild west of finance—exciting and full of possibility. But shady contracts and clumsy UX made me slow down and think twice. Initially I thought wallets were just vaults for private keys, but then I realized the real friction is how users connect to decentralized exchanges and manage liquidity pools through interfaces, which is where WalletConnect and smart wallet integrations either smooth the ride or trip people up badly.

Really?

Trading on DEXs is no longer just about clicking a swap button for tokens. Things like liquidity pools, slippage, impermanent loss, and sudden gas spikes truly matter. Wallet UX shapes those outcomes because connection methods can hide critical choices from users. Actually, wait—let me rephrase that: the connection layer (WalletConnect or injected wallets) is often the user’s first decision point, and when that layer is confusing or insecure, it cascades into bad trades, lost funds, or abandoned liquidity positions, which is why improving that flow is very very important to DeFi usability and safety.

Hmm…

My instinct said mobile wallets were niche, but adoption surprised me. On one hand mobile-first WalletConnect sessions make onboarding smoother for newcomers. On the other hand desktop users often expect browser extensions and a different mental model. On balance, though actually I now think the best interfaces treat WalletConnect and injected extensions as interchangeable paths that converge into one coherent UX, letting users pick their comfort zone while preserving safety guards like transaction previews, chain validation, and clear fee displays.

Whoa!

Here’s what bugs me about many wallet integrations: they hide important details behind layers. There’s somethin’ about infinite approvals that makes me uneasy. That lack of transparency fuels mistakes like signing malicious approvals or leaving broad allowances. I’m biased, but when a DEX flow makes approval an implicit step, users often grant broad permissions out of impatience or confusion, and those decisions are precisely what attackers exploit, so designing clear, stepwise prompts and optional allowance limits is a very concrete, practical way to reduce systemic risk.

Okay.

Liquidity pools look simple, but their dynamics are surprisingly nuanced and risky. I’ll be honest, impermanent loss bugs me more than the hype suggests. Providing liquidity requires understanding pricing curves, capital utilization, and impermanent loss math. Initially I thought impermanent loss was an abstract term that only active arbitrageurs needed to worry about, but after farming on a new pool during a volatile week I watched my TVL swing and my intuition changed— I experienced firsthand how fees, time horizon, and the pool composition alter outcomes, and that memory stuck with me.

Seriously?

WalletConnect solves a big usability gap, letting mobile wallets talk to web dapps securely. Something felt off about relying on browser extensions alone, since extensions can be phished. WalletConnect’s session model, when implemented well, shows origin, methods, and requested scopes. On one hand WalletConnect adds complexity because implementations vary wildly across dapps and wallets, though on the other hand it unlocks richer UX patterns like deep linking, transaction batching, and hardware-backed approvals, and with standardization we could make permission UIs consistent and much safer for mainstream users (oh, and by the way… some wallets already do a better job at this than others).

Wow!

If you want practical self-custody that still plays nicely with DEXs, consider upgrading your wallet setup. I’m not endorsing every product, but I found a neat balance between UX and control in some solutions. For a hands-on approach try the uniswap wallet as an example of a modern interface that integrates WalletConnect-friendly flows. That said, choosing a wallet is about trade-offs: you can chase maximum security with cold-storage-only setups or prioritize seamless trading with guarded hot wallets, and your decision should reflect your risk tolerance, trading frequency, and whether you want to provide liquidity or just swap occasionally.

Hmm…

Best practices are simple to state but harder to follow consistently. Use WalletConnect when it fits, revoke permissions regularly, and prefer limited allowances. Also keep a separate wallet for liquidity provision and another for casual swaps—it’s a small discipline that reduces big headaches. On balance, I’ve seen traders avoid disaster by using session whitelists, reading transaction details, and relying on wallets that emphasize explicit confirmations rather than burying decisions, and building those habits matters more than chasing the newest yield farm.

I’ll be honest…

There are no silver bullets in DeFi security or UX. Designers, devs, and users all share responsibility for safer liquidity experiences. On one hand the tech is mature enough for real products, though on the other hand we still need better permission models and education. So my final take is pragmatic optimism: keep practicing self-custody basics, prefer wallets that expose clear transaction metadata and WalletConnect sessions, split your activities across accounts, and don’t be afraid to step back when something smells phishy—this approach won’t make DeFi risk-free, but it will tilt the odds in your favor and leave you more comfortable with the system’s trade-offs…

[Illustration of a user connecting a mobile wallet to a DEX using WalletConnect]

Practical tips and a quick checklist

Start with two wallets: one for casual swaps and another for liquidity provisioning. Use WalletConnect for mobile convenience and hardware wallets for large positions. Read approvals before signing, prefer limited allowances, and revoke unused sessions. Keep firmware and apps updated, and consider small test transactions when trying new dapps. If something pushes you to skip details, that’s a hard pass signal—slow down and verify.

FAQ

How does WalletConnect improve security compared to browser extensions?

WalletConnect moves the private key off the web page and onto your device, which reduces exposure to DOM-based phishing and malicious scripts; however, its security depends on session handling and the wallet’s UI, so consistent permission displays and explicit transaction details remain essential.

Should I use the same wallet for swapping and providing liquidity?

Technically you can, but separating activities across wallets limits blast radius if approvals are abused; think of one wallet like your daily driver and another like a savings jar—it’s a simple habit that prevents big headaches down the road.